About this game
In his second adventure James Pond must retrieve the toys Dr Maybe has stolen.
Pond has been armed with an Inspector Gadget-style stretch device, which he can use to view higher areas or claw onto ceilings so as to slide across them.

The gameplay takes place across worlds themed around particular types of toys, such as sporting goods, candy and aircraft.
The levels scroll sideways, although a small amount of vertical movement is included.
On each level Pond must collect 2 penguins and reach the exit, although there are usually multiple exits and lots of secret areas to explore.
After completing each pair of two worlds (each of which has three sub levels), a boss must be faced.
About Super Nintendo Entertainment System
The Super Nintendo Entertainment System (1990/1991) is widely regarded as home to one of the strongest first-party libraries in gaming history, from Super Metroid to Chrono Trigger. It's a mature collecting market: iconic RPGs and late-cycle releases (which typically had smaller print runs as the industry moved toward the next generation) are consistently among the most sought-after and valuable cartridges from the 16-bit era.
